Агуулгын хүснэгт:

Та C++ хэл дээр анхдагч аргументыг хэрхэн дамжуулах вэ?
Та C++ хэл дээр анхдагч аргументыг хэрхэн дамжуулах вэ?

Видео: Та C++ хэл дээр анхдагч аргументыг хэрхэн дамжуулах вэ?

Видео: Та C++ хэл дээр анхдагч аргументыг хэрхэн дамжуулах вэ?
Видео: C++ програмчлалын заавар 71 - Өгөгдмөл аргументууд 2024, May
Anonim

онд C++ програмчлал, та хангаж чадна анхдагч функцийн утгууд параметрүүд . Цаана нь санаа анхдагч аргумент энгийн. Хэрэв функцийг дуудвал дамжуулсан аргумент /s, тэдгээр аргументууд функцэд ашигладаг. Гэхдээ хэрэв маргаан Функцийг дуудах үед /s дамжуулагдахгүй бол, the анхдагч утгуудыг ашигладаг.

Зүгээр л, C++ дээр анхдагч аргумент гэж юу вэ?

Өгөгдмөл аргументууд C++ дээр A анхдагч аргумент Энэ нь функцийг дуудагч нь утгыг өгөөгүй тохиолдолд хөрвүүлэгчээс автоматаар оноодог функцийн мэдэгдэлд заасан утга юм. маргаан хамт а анхдагч үнэ цэнэ. Дараах нь энгийн зүйл юм C++ хэрэглээг харуулах жишээ анхдагч аргументууд.

Үүний нэгэн адил, анхдагч аргумент бүхий бүтээгчийг тодорхойлох боломжтой юу? Бүх функцүүдийн нэгэн адил a бүтээгч байж болох анхдагч аргументууд . Эдгээрийг гишүүн объектуудыг эхлүүлэхэд ашигладаг. Хэрэв а бүтээгч ямар ч байна аргументууд гэж байхгүй анхдагч үнэт зүйлс, энэ нь биш юм анхдагч бүтээгч . Дараах жишээ нь нэг ангитай ангиллыг тодорхойлдог бүтээгч ба хоёр анхдагч бүтээгчид.

Мөн функцэд өгөгдмөл параметрийн аргумент ашиглах нь ямар ашигтай вэ?

Ans The өгөгдмөл параметрийг ашиглах давуу тал / функц дэх аргумент дараах байдалтай байна: ✓ Тэдгээрийг шинээр нэмэхэд ашиглаж болно параметрүүд байгаа руу функц . ✓ Тэдгээрийг ижил төстэй хослуулахад ашиглаж болно функц нэг болгон.

C++ хэл дээр өгөгдсөн үндсэн функцууд юу вэ?

Програм хангамж хөгжүүлэгч ангид хэрэгжүүлээгүй тохиолдолд C++ хэл дээрх хөрвүүлэгчийн өгсөн өгөгдмөл функцуудыг доор харуулав

  • Өгөгдмөл үүсгэгч.
  • Хуулбар үүсгэгч.
  • Даалгаврын оператор.
  • Устгагч.